Review of Noblesville, Indiana


Beware
Star Rating - 4/14/2024
Worst decision to have moved here due to poor city planning and unhealthy exposure to industrial toxins. Overbuilding of apts and low end housing lowers surrounding property values and impacts overcrowded schools, traffic, roads, crime, etc. our careless and ruthless mayor has no problem allowing toxic mines to encroach on residential neighborhoods. Dewatering and placing the wetlands and aquifers at risk puts everyone’s water supply in a dangerous situation. Noblesville had such potential but the beautiful lands are being decimated by poor and unhealthy planning.
